Michael Wedge
Getaway, Oil Painting

2021

About the Item

Artist Comments
"Figures move through a surreal landscape occupied by elements from the city and the countryside," explains artist Michael Wedge. Michael creates a curious juxtaposition of everyday city street life and sprawling nature. People move about as if through normal traffic, with a yellow taxi's tires submerged in tall dry grass.


About the Artist
Michael Wedge works in a variety of mediums: sculpture, painting, mixed media and more. He oftentimes starts with a mental image and creates digital collages, which become the basis for his paintings. A lot of his work references themes from his personal life, such as the experience of living in a city versus in the countryside. If his art seems mysterious, it;s because he enjoys making complex works. "I am attracted to images or moments that seem to have something subtle or hidden under the surface," he explains. When he;s not making art, he teaches it at an elementary school.

  • Nowhere to Go but Up, Oil Painting
    By Diane Flick
    Located in San Francisco, CA

    Artist Comments
    "This painting celebrates the joy and the art of the frolic, the fanciful, and the free!" says artist Diane Flick. Loosely inspired by Mary Poppins with a nod to her in the title, Diane explores her playful imagination by drawing an expansive landscape with random and happy imagery conceived in pure delight. Having just given birth to her second child when beginning this piece, Diane spent that summer enjoying the new addition to her family, rolling down imaginary hills with childlike enthusiasm, wrapping herself in the sweetness of new motherhood again, and painting.


    About the Artist
    Diane Flick is a Bay Area artist who paints quirky portraits of robots with a playful color palette and masterful realism. Each of Diane’s robots expresses its own humanlike and idiosyncratic personality. From an early age, she had a fascination with inanimate objects and often imagined what they would be like with human characteristics. Her portfolio explores the human experience through non-human subjects.

  • A Quiet Country Home
    By Sharon France
    Located in San Francisco, CA

    Artist Comments
    I live on an old farmstead in the Midwest where I paint quiet, country scenes from my imagination. These contemporary folk art landscapes are created simply from the heart. I want to capture the feeling of peace and serenity that I love about the country. This painting was inspired from old country houses I have seen over the years on rural back roads. I set the house in a simple, slightly abstracted golden field with a blue sky filled with wispy clouds. This piece is on a gallery wrapped canvas and the painting continues around the sides. The work comes ready to hang.

    About the Artist
    Sharon France has many fond childhood memories of visits to her grandparents; remote Midwestern farm. She now lives on her own farmstead with her family where she paints the beauty around her. Sharon found inspiration in the work of Hudson River School Artists, Minimalists, Tonalists and Realists. When she;s not painting, she loves to hike. She currently lives in Illinois. Fun fact: her homestead includes a number of pet birds like heritage turkeys, chickens, ducks and tiny finches.
